Policy Limits

Car accidents can cause injuries that are serious, and the victims are left with costly medical and repair expenses. If the cost is greater than the insurance policy of the driver who was at fault limits an individual injury lawsuit could be the best way to pursue compensation.

The adjuster will determine the amount of money that the policy covers when a claim is submitted to an insurance company for the party at fault. Although this amount may vary from one state to the next, it is usually what is covered under liability insurance for the person in question.

While the insurance company can not settle a claim that is in excess of its policy limits but they are not required to pay more than what it legally has to pay. In rare cases however, it's possible to claim over the policy limits.


A qualified personal injury attorney is recommended for those who have suffered severe injuries from an auto accident and the costs of recovery are higher than your insurance coverage. Our lawyers can assist you to get the money you deserve from the at-fault party as well as their insurance company in order to pay your medical expenses as well as lost wages, pain and suffering, and loss of quality of life.

If the insurance company is unable to settle the claim within their policy limits, our lawyers may also sue them for bad good faith. This is a unique, but important strategy that can lead to the at-fault party being held responsible for the entire amount of a jury verdict.

The law in Texas permits the "true Stowers doctrine" claim to be made, which means that an at-fault driver's insurance company can be held responsible for the full amount of monetary damages that a jury awards in excess of their liability policy limits. This is a powerful strategy for those who have suffered severe injuries that require costly and intensive treatment for example, a traumatic head injury or spinal cord injury.

Typically, these claims are based on a mix of non-economic and economic damages. These could include the victim's present, past and future medical expenses; future lost wages or income; pain and suffering; loss of enjoyment of life and emotional trauma.
